Responsibilities
Duties are based on the candidate’s qualifications and cover Class 2, Class 3, Class 4, and Class 5 Service Technician roles:
- Class 2 Service Technician
- Ability to read schematics
- Understanding of up to 20-ton unitary DX equipment
- Understanding of psychometrics
- Basic understanding of Controls
- Basic understanding of Quoting
- Diagnosing refrigerant system issues
- Class 3 Service Technician
- Understanding of 5 through 100-ton unitary DX equipment, chilled water air handlers, computer room units (CRAC), Pneumatic and DDC controls
- Demonstrate advanced troubleshooting skills on 100-ton and less unitary DX equipment
- Capable of all repairs needed on rooftop package equipment
- Perform basic troubleshooting on air-cooled chillers
- Troubleshoot and repair water-cooled package equipment
- Diagnose problems using electrical schematics
- Diagnosing refrigerant system issues
- Basic understanding of variable frequency drives
- Diagnose issues with variable air volume equipment (VAV’s/PIU’s)
- Class 4 Service Technician
- All skills listed in the Class 3 category
- Troubleshooting and repairs on all types of air-cooled chillers, pumps, and low-pressure boilers
- Advanced troubleshooting on all air-cooled equipment, both unitary and chilled water
- Basic understanding of water-cooled chillers
- Basic understanding of DDC control systems
- Capable of maintaining and repairing cooling towers
- Ability to diagnose water flow issues
- Proficient with variable frequency drives and starters
- Proficient with low-pressure boilers
- Class 5 Service Technician
- All skills listed in the Class 3 and Class 4 sections
- Understanding of water-cooled chillers, chilled water systems, large chiller rebuilds, rigging, large boilers, pumps, and assist with technical support to other technicians
- Troubleshoot, maintain, and repair large, water-cooled chillers
- Diagnose issues on large boilers with power burners
- Advanced diagnosis of air distribution systems (VAV/PIU)
- Chilled water system distribution and troubleshooting
- Troubleshoot and repair/rebuild large pumps
- Possess superior system knowledge and advanced troubleshooting skills
